Cultural context

'Breathe' as a single-word mindfulness instruction entered mainstream wellness culture in the 2010s alongside the explosion of meditation apps, breathwork therapy, and anxiety-management content. The word is used in clinical contexts (panic-attack intervention scripts almost always begin with 'breathe'), in tattoo culture (where it serves as a permanent self-regulation reminder), and in yoga studios. As a morse tattoo, 'breathe' is primarily worn by people managing anxiety or chronic stress — the word functions both as a reminder to the wearer and as a private anchor for a mindfulness practice. How the morse encodes

'BREATHE' is 22 elements: B (dah-di-di-dit), R (di-dah-dit), E (one dot), A (di-dah), T (one dash), H (four dots), E (one dot). The two single-dot E's at positions 3 and 7 create natural pauses in the CW rhythm — heard at a slow tempo, the word actually sounds like it has breathing spaces built in. That sonic quality mirrors the word's meaning in an unusually direct way.
